Walker also said the game loads "crazy fast" on PS5, and it makes use of 3D audio. In a post on the PlayStation Blog, Capcom producer Matt Walker said Devil May Cry 5 Special Edition runs at 120 frames per second (with a compatible display) via the new High Framerate mode. "At present, there are no plans to release DMC5SE on PC." "Devil May Cry 5 Special Edition is specifically being developed and optimised to benefit the system architecture and leap in processing power offered by PS5 and Xbox Series X, so we're focusing on these platforms," a Capcom spokesperson told Eurogamer. While Vergil will be sold as a DLC character for all platforms, the other content and features included in the Special Edition will not hit PC. It turns out this Special Edition is for PS5 and Xbox Series X only - and won't be released for PC. Each arm has a different ability, allowing Nero to execute a wide array of combos in a single fight. It's replaced by a series of robotic arms (called Devil Breakers) created by Nero's partner in demon-fighting crime, Nico. Nero historically has a demon-powered arm called Devil Bringer, and it's ripped from his body at the beginning of Devil May Cry 5. ![]() Ninja Theory briefly took over the franchise with DmC: Devil May Cry in 2013, and while Devil May Cry 5 takes some styling tips from that game, it doesn't follow its storyline directly.ĭevil May Cry 5 picks up where Devil May Cry 4 left off, and it features three playable characters: Dante (long-time series protagonist), Nero (the star of Devil May Cry 4) and an unknown character in a long black trench vest. Devil May Cry 5 is the sequel to Devil May Cry 4, which came out in 2008, and it marks the return of series shepherd Hideaki Itsuno as director. Devil May Cry 5 is due to land on Xbox One, PlayStation 4 and PC on March 8th, 2019, Capcom announced today during the special Gamescom edition of the Inside Xbox livestream. ![]()
